Quote:
Originally Posted by cbkihong
What about

for FILE in `ls *.csv`; do
echo $FILE >> $LOGFILE
done

Not only is ls unnecessary, it will break the script if any filenames contain spaces or other pathological characters. Use the wildcard directly:

Code:
for FILE in *.csv

However, if all you want to do is print the names of the files to another file, you don't need a loop:

Code:
printf "%s\n" *.csv > "$LOGFILE"

How to get extension of a file in unix kshell

Hi,

How do I get extension of a file in a unix dir.

I need to code a script that finds out the extension of a file, say Rpt200.txt
. The result should fetch txt

Or if the file does not have an extension say Rtp200 how to know if it doesn't have an extension

Code:
file=Rpt200.txt
case $file in
     *.*) ext=${file##*.} ;;
     *) ext= ;;
esac
